Bitsize Gos – Liberty Lies

Ross tries to squash rumours surrounding Liberty Media and possible Bernie F1-exit….     Ross Brawn has been surrounded by rumours admits the Liberty-Media buyout, with many believing that he will replace Bernie in the coming years.   But now it seems Ross has emerged to put the rumours to rest.   'Liberty have not got far enough down the road to make any commitments yet,' Brawn stated   'I'm doing a little consulting to help them better understand F1 but that's all.“   When asked by a German Publication, Brawn also iterated that he would not take over any technical or sporting roles because it 'all depends'  on Bernie.
